MPD Swears in Two New Officers

Both officers have law enforcement experience

shelpman(Photo Provided Officer Shelpman)

 

potter(Photo Provided Officer Potter)

 

 

Curtis J. Shelpman and Kyle W. Potter a took their oaths of office to become the two newest members of the Madison Police Department.

Shelpman has two years of law enforcement experience, has completed training and been assigned to patrol duties.
